§ 23-74-8. Disciplinary actions.

Forms of disciplinary action. When the director finds that an unlicensed health care practitioner has violated any provision of this chapter, the director may take one or more of the following actions, only against the individual practitioner:

(1) Revoke the right to practice;

(2) Suspend the right to practice;

(3) Impose limitations or conditions on the practitioner's provision of unlicensed health care practices, impose rehabilitation requirements, or require practice under supervision;
